Webb18 nov. 2024 · In primary cicatricial alopecia (PCA), hair follicle destruction leads to irreversible fibrosis and scalp scarring [ 1 ]. Central centrifugal cicatricial alopecia (CCCA) is a frequently encountered PCA subtype that primarily affects middle-aged women of African descent [ 2, 3, 4 ].
